Land taken for the Purposes of a Road in Block XII, Linkwater Survey District.

[L.S.]
GALWAY, Governor-General.
By his Deputy,
MICHAEL MYERS.
A PROCLAMATION.

IN pursuance and exercise of the powers and authorities vested in me by the Public Works Act, 1928, and of every other power and authority in anywise enabling me in this behalf, I, George Vere Arundell, Viscount Galway,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for the purposes of a road; and I do also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ect on and after the thirty-first day of July, one thousand nine hundred and thirty-nine.

SCHEDULE.

APPROXIMATE area of the piece of land taken: 1 rood 22·85 perches.
Being portion of Section 12.

Situated in Block XII, Linkwater Survey District (Picton Suburban R.D.). (S.O. R 504/40.)

In the Marlborough Land District; as the same is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 99863,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ured violet.

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, and issued under the Seal of that Dominion, this 25th day of July, 1939.

R. SEMPLE, Minister of Public Works.
